Végre volt egy kis időm, hogy a tárgybeli cucc "algoritmusát" megírjam - ami "algoritmus" az én ízlésemnek kicsit komplikált, egy "funny" felhasználóbartá szoftver esetében. Pláne, hogy irányomba történt személyes megkeresés is volt az ügyben.
FELADAT: A "view data"-hoz hasonló kétdimenziós táblát szeretnénk a "nagy" Tableau-ban is, natúr, nyers adatok formájában - mindenféle pivotálás meg üzleti intelligencia okosság nélkül megjeleníteni.
MEGOLDÁS:
1.
A Tableau megnyitása, vegyük a Tableau-hozdemóként kapott SuperStore Excel-t.
2.
Az adatforráson jobb egérklikk után nézzünk bele az adatokba, hogy mit is szeretnénk látni.
Az adatok mellett (amit majd látni szeretnénk), látjuk, hogy 9.426 rekordunk van az Excel-ben.
4.
Baloldalon a "Measures"-nél, az üres fehér részen jobb egérklikk után "Create Calculated Field"-er válasszunk.
5.
A megnyíló ablakban hívjuk az ujonnan kalkulált mezőnket ROWNUM-nak, a számítási képlete meg legyen INDEX(). A dolog vélja, hogy be tudjuk sorszámozni a rekordjainkat (mesterséges integer ID)
6.
Az OK-ra való enter után megjelenik szépen a ROWNUM.
7
Vonszoljunk fel "drag and drop"-pal ezt a ROWNUM-ot a "Rows"-hoz
8.
Ott fenn, jobb egérklikk után "Compute using" és "Table (Across)"-t válasszuk ki.
9.
Majd ismét jobb egérklikk és következzék a "Discrete"
10.
Zöldből kékbe váltott a ROWNUM ennek nyomán.
11.
A "Dimensions"-ből a predefinit "Measure Names-t" vonszoljuk a a "Columns"-ba
12.
A "Measure Names"-n jobb egérklikk, és pipáljuk be a a "Show Quick Filter"-t. Ezzel tudjuk majd ki be kapcsolgatni, hogy mely mezők jelenjenek meg.
13.
A "Filters"-ek között is megjelenik ezáltal a "Measure Names"
14.
Vonszoljuk a "Measures"-ből a szintén predefinit "Measure Values"-t az "ABC-Text"-be (ott engedjük el).
Ezzel megjelennek a measure-jeink, az első rekordra.
15.
A "Dimensions"-ből vonszoljuk például a "RowID"-t a "ROWNUM" mellé.
Egyelőre azt látjuk, hogy a "ROWNUM"=1 minden rekordra.
16.
A "ROWNUM"-on jobb egérklikk, és ismét állítsuk be, hogy Table (Down)
17.
Ezennel szépen egyesével fognak növekedni a ROWNUM-ok, amit akartunk.
18.
És most jön az egész mókolás után az orgazmusos rész: vonszoljuk a Dimensions-ből "Ship Mode"-t a "RowID" mellé. Nem kellett "Measure"-ré alakítani egy dimenziót, mégsincs pivotálás, hanem rekordonként szépen megjelenik a dimenzio értéke, amit el akartunk érni.
Eddigi TABLEAU-blogposztjaim:
2013.06.17 - Data Science: Tableau-feladatok
2013.06.22 - Tableau: Egy vizualizációs stratégia lehetséges szubjektív sarokpontjai
2013-07-05 - Tableau: Mindennapi örömök
2013.07.09 - Tableau: Eset a NEM-létező egzotikus nagygépes adatpiaccal
2013.11.16 - Tableau: Aktuális Pros/Cons egyenleg
2013.11.17 - Tableau: Text Table
Ha valakinek még nincs meg a Tableau-szoftver, miközben szeretne engedni a birtoklási csábításnak, az alábbi mail-címen egy kedves, fiatal, aranyos kolléganő igyekszik hatékony és konkrét eszközök segítségével ápolni minden Tableau-vonzatú kapcsolatot. Illetve biztos segít optimális árat találni a termékhez vezető rögös úton. :)
hello@tableausoftware.hu
Nincsenek megjegyzések:
Megjegyzés küldése